Just found a bomb of a saving, going from Huddersfield to Northampton on a Saturday, surprisingly still getting return tickets rather than singles.
**Prices in brackets are with 16-25 railcard**
Huddersfield - Northampton: Off Peak Return = £61.50 (£40.60)
But, splitting at Manchester Piccadilly AND Stoke-on-Trent, the cost is nearly halved.
Huddersfield to Manchester Piccadilly: Off Peak Day Return = £9.50 (£6.25)
Manchester Piccadilly to Stoke-on-Trent: Off Peak Day Return = £10.00 (£6.60)
Stoke-on-Trent to Northampton: Super Off Peak Return = £12.00 (£7.90)
Total Cost: £31.50 (£20.75), a saving of £30 (£19.85), that's about 49%.0 -
